Output 6893bbf0b55d74c12903ba2c7cf034939fb43e7c3756e275dc65744980115f39:3

value
1444469
script pubkey
OP_0 OP_PUSHBYTES_20 e712f8c8bbe1d2b8a16f055b0dfd70cb848e5103
address
bc1quuf03j9mu8ft3gt0q4dsmltsewzgu5gr9wxyw0
transaction
6893bbf0b55d74c12903ba2c7cf034939fb43e7c3756e275dc65744980115f39
spent
false